Understanding the Fuel Filter and Its Role
A fuel filter is a critical component in your vehicle's fuel system. It is designed to trap impurities such as rust, dirt, and other particles from the fuel before it reaches the engine. Clean fuel is vital for the proper functioning of fuel injectors, carburetors, and combustion chambers. Over time, the filter accumulates these contaminants, which can restrict fuel flow and lead to engine problems. There are two main types of fuel filters: inline filters, which are located along the fuel line, and in-tank filters, which are integrated into the fuel pump assembly. Knowing your filter type is the first step in the cleaning process. Most modern vehicles use inline filters, but consulting your owner's manual can confirm this. The filter's material, often made of paper, mesh, or synthetic media, determines how it should be cleaned. For instance, some filters are reusable and designed for cleaning, while others are disposable and require replacement. This guide focuses on cleaning reusable filters, as replacing disposable ones is a different procedure. Signs That Your Fuel Filter Needs Cleaning
Recognizing when to clean your fuel filter can prevent major engine issues. Common indicators include engine sputtering or hesitation during acceleration, especially at higher speeds. This happens because a clogged filter restricts fuel flow, causing the engine to starve for fuel. You might also experience rough idling, where the engine shakes or stalls when the vehicle is stationary. Another sign is a noticeable decrease in fuel economy; if the filter is dirty, the engine works harder, consuming more fuel. In severe cases, the engine may fail to start altogether, as insufficient fuel reaches the combustion chamber. For diesel engines, symptoms can include black smoke from the exhaust or loss of power. It is important to note that these signs can also relate to other fuel system problems, such as a faulty fuel pump or dirty injectors. However, cleaning the fuel filter is a good starting point for diagnosis and maintenance. Regular inspection every 10,000 to 15,000 miles is recommended, but this varies based on driving conditions. If you frequently drive in dusty areas or use lower-quality fuel, more frequent cleaning may be necessary. Tools and Materials Required for Cleaning
Before starting, gather all necessary tools and materials to ensure a smooth and safe cleaning process. You will need basic hand tools such as wrenches, screwdrivers, and pliers, depending on your vehicle's filter housing. Safety gear is crucial: wear protective gloves and safety glasses to shield yourself from fuel and debris. Have a container ready to catch any spilled fuel, and work in a well-ventilated area to avoid inhaling fumes. For the cleaning itself, you will need a clean rag, a soft-bristle brush, and a suitable cleaning solution. Isopropyl alcohol or a specialized fuel system cleaner is effective for dissolving residues without damaging the filter media. Avoid using harsh chemicals like gasoline or solvents, as they can degrade the filter material. Additionally, keep a bucket of water and baking soda nearby for emergency spills, as fuel is flammable. If your filter is heavily clogged, consider having a replacement filter on hand in case cleaning is insufficient. Safety Precautions to Follow
Safety is paramount when working with fuel systems. Always disconnect the vehicle's battery before beginning to prevent accidental sparks that could ignite fuel. Relieve fuel system pressure by locating the fuel pump fuse or relay in the fuse box and removing it while the engine is off. Then, start the engine and let it run until it stalls, which indicates pressure has been released. Never smoke or use open flames near the work area, as fuel vapors are highly flammable. Work in a cool, shaded spot to reduce vapor accumulation. When handling the fuel filter, use a container to collect any residual fuel, and dispose of it properly at a designated recycling center. Wear gloves to protect your skin from irritation, and avoid getting fuel in your eyes or mouth. If fuel spills occur, clean them immediately with baking soda and water. Additionally, ensure the vehicle is parked on a flat surface with the parking brake engaged to prevent rolling. Step-by-Step Process to Clean a Fuel Filter
Follow these numbered steps to clean your fuel filter thoroughly. This process applies to most reusable inline filters; adjust based on your vehicle's specifications.
Step 1: Locate the Fuel Filter
Refer to your owner's manual to find the fuel filter's position. In most cars, it is along the fuel line, under the vehicle or in the engine bay. For inline filters, look for a cylindrical component with fuel lines connected on both ends. Use a flashlight if needed for better visibility.
Step 2: Disconnect the Fuel Lines
Place a container under the filter to catch fuel. Using wrenches, carefully loosen the fittings on both ends of the filter. Some filters have quick-connect fittings that require a special tool to release. Slow and steady pressure helps avoid damage. Once loose, gently pull the lines away and let any remaining fuel drain into the container.
Step 3: Remove the Filter
After disconnecting the lines, unbolt or unclip the filter from its mounting bracket. Handle it gently to prevent bending or cracking. Inspect the filter for visible damage; if it is cracked or worn, replacement is better than cleaning. Set the filter on a clean surface for cleaning.
Step 4: Disassemble the Filter (If Applicable)
Some filters have a housing that can be opened. Use a screwdriver or wrench to separate the housing carefully. Remove the filter element, which is the internal part that traps contaminants. Note the orientation for reassembly.
Step 5: Clean the Filter Element
Submerge the filter element in a container filled with isopropyl alcohol or fuel system cleaner. Let it soak for 15-20 minutes to loosen debris. Then, use a soft-bristle brush to gently scrub the surface, moving in the direction of fuel flow to avoid pushing dirt deeper. Rinse with clean alcohol and shake off excess liquid. Do not use water, as it can leave residues.
Step 6: Dry the Filter
Allow the filter to air-dry completely in a well-ventilated area. This may take a few hours. Avoid using compressed air or heat sources, as they can damage the media. Ensure it is fully dry before reinstalling to prevent moisture from entering the fuel system.
Step 7: Reassemble and Reinstall
Once dry, reassemble the filter housing if it was disassembled. Check the O-rings and gaskets for wear; replace them if necessary. Position the filter back in its mounting bracket and reconnect the fuel lines, tightening fittings securely but not over-tightening. Ensure all connections are snug to prevent leaks.
Step 8: Test for Leaks
Reconnect the battery and turn the ignition to the "on" position without starting the engine. This primes the fuel system. Inspect the filter and connections for any leaks. If leaks are detected, turn off the ignition and tighten fittings. Start the engine and let it idle, monitoring for irregularities. Take a short test drive to confirm normal performance.
Post-Cleaning Checks and Maintenance
After cleaning, perform additional checks to ensure optimal function. Monitor fuel pressure if you have a gauge; normal levels are specified in your manual. Listen for unusual noises from the fuel pump, which could indicate residual blockages. Check fuel economy over the next few tanks; improvement suggests successful cleaning. To maintain the filter, incorporate cleaning into your regular maintenance schedule. For most vehicles, cleaning every 15,000 miles is sufficient, but adjust based on driving habits. Use high-quality fuel to reduce contaminant buildup. Inspect the filter during oil changes for early signs of clogging. Keeping a log of cleaning dates helps track intervals. If symptoms persist after cleaning, consult a professional, as there may be underlying issues like a failing fuel pump or dirty injectors. Common Mistakes to Avoid
Avoid these pitfalls to ensure a successful cleaning. Do not use compressed air to dry the filter, as it can tear the media. Never clean a disposable filter; this can compromise its integrity and lead to engine damage. Avoid skipping safety steps, such as relieving fuel pressure, which risks fires or injuries. Do not over-tighten fittings, as this can strip threads and cause leaks. Using inappropriate cleaners, like bleach or gasoline, can degrade the filter and harm the fuel system. Rushing the drying process may leave moisture, promoting corrosion. Ignoring worn O-rings during reassembly can result in leaks. Finally, do not neglect post-cleaning tests; they are crucial for verifying the repair. By steering clear of these errors, you enhance safety and effectiveness.
When to Seek Professional Help
While cleaning a fuel filter is a manageable DIY task, there are times to call a professional. If you lack the tools or confidence, a mechanic can ensure proper handling. For vehicles with complex fuel systems, such as modern hybrids or diesels, expert knowledge may be needed. If cleaning does not resolve issues like poor performance or starting problems, deeper diagnostics are required. Professionals have equipment to test fuel pressure and injector function accurately. Additionally, if the filter is damaged or non-reusable, replacement is best done by a technician to guarantee compatibility.
